DISCUSSION MAIN THANG - PC S1E4 - Purchase Episode Details Air Date: 8/16/26Written by: Brian Prodi FlynnDirected by: Erik KlingGuest Stars: Nat Faxon, Gillian Jacobs, Rafael Petardi, Danny Pudi Official Synopsis After finding an addendum on the Louisiana Purchase receipt, Curtis must race against old enemies and friends to hold control of the territory. Our Synopsis: The French try to take back ⅓ of the USA using a wrinkled old Napoleon dong. From Mike van Dooyeweert (DOY-uh-vayrt) Hi Travis and Brondon, Something that didn't even cross my mind while watching, but only when you were started talking about it: could the whole 'drug lab', the barrels and especially the opening sequence be a nod to Breaking Bad? The cold open did, in hindsight, remind me of the cold opens you'd often see on Breaking Bad, especially in the seasons with the underground lab.
